Key Food, as a larger entity, has a fascinating history in its own right. It’s a cooperative of independently owned grocery stores, a model that empowers local entrepreneurs and allows them to tailor their offerings to the specific needs of their communities. This cooperative structure is key to understanding why Key Food Nostrand feels so deeply embedded in Crown Heights. It’s not just another faceless corporate chain; it’s a business owned and operated by individuals who are invested in the success and well-being of their neighbors. Aisle by Aisle: Products and Services Designed for Crown Heights
Step inside Key Food Nostrand, and you’re immediately greeted by a wide array of products designed to cater to the diverse culinary traditions of Crown Heights. The produce section bursts with color, offering everything from everyday staples like apples and bananas to more exotic fruits and vegetables favored in Caribbean and Latin American cuisine. Meats and poultry are plentiful, with options to suit various dietary needs and preferences. Dairy products, pantry staples, and a wide selection of international foods round out the offerings.
What truly sets Key Food Nostrand apart is its commitment to stocking items that resonate with the specific needs of its community. This includes a dedicated Kosher section, offering a wide range of certified products that adhere to Jewish dietary laws. Caribbean ingredients, such as plantains, yams, and spices, are readily available, reflecting the strong Caribbean heritage of many Crown Heights residents. The store understands that its customers are not just looking for groceries; they are looking for the ingredients that connect them to their heritage and allow them to prepare the meals they grew up with.
